Output 324ecc8eb68d184c913dc95fec04112e6b04f4be8dddf5dc991d2fb81b5996dd:24

value
10415
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d21075997e0e9c8a8d0d43feb606cb2652c9bc7688e8567bca91226cef4850ee
address
ltc1p6gg8txt7p6wg4rgdg0ltvpktyefvn0rk3r59v772jy3xem6g2rhqtngz4a
transaction
324ecc8eb68d184c913dc95fec04112e6b04f4be8dddf5dc991d2fb81b5996dd
spent
true